This is one of the most common myths! Many people believe that they have to wait until it reaches 100% before turning on their new iPhone.
The truth is that The iPhone leaves the factory already charged., usually around 50-60%. You can open it and use it immediately, without any delay.
Modern batteries do not require calibration or a special “first charge.” As soon as you open the box, you are ready to use it normally!
This comes from the days of old batteries that had “memory” problems. Back then, they really had to be completely drained to work properly.
Today's batteries work in a completely different way. It's best to keep them between 20% and 80%. If you let them drop to 0% frequently, their lifespan will be reduced.
Think of it like your own energy: better to have small, frequent “fills” than to run out completely. The same goes for your battery!
In the past, there was indeed a fear of overload. But today things are completely different.
iPhone automatically cuts off power when it reaches 100%. It does not continue to "draw" current, so there is no risk of overloading.
It also features the “Optimized Charging” feature, which learns when you wake up and completes charging to 100% just before you start your day. This protects the battery even more!
The most important factor for a healthy battery is the right temperature. Batteries do not like extreme heat or extreme cold.
The safe operating temperature is approximately 0°C to 35°C. What does this mean in practice?
- Don't leave it in the car. in the summer or in the sun
- Don't charge it under the pillow. or in a place that retains heat
- Take out the case. if it gets too hot while charging
- Avoid prolonged use. at very low temperatures
If the temperature rises, iPhone will warn you. Then simply let it cool down before continuing to use or charge.
From the iPhone 8 onwards, everything supports fast charging. With a powerful charger, you can get to 50% in about 30 minutes.
Fast charging is safe, but it makes the device hotter. And as we've seen, heat reduces battery life.
When to use it:
- When you're in a hurry and you need immediate charging
- Occasionally and not every day
For everyday charging—such as overnight—a simple charger is more "gentle" and ideal for longer battery life.
